Housing & Urban Development Corporation Limited Earnings Summary — Q4 FY2026
HUDCO Reports Extraordinary Net Profit Surge in Q4 FY2026 Supported by Unusual Tax Benefits
Key Takeaways
- Net Profit surged to ₹1,981 Cr in Q4 FY2026, primarily driven by a massive tax reversal/benefit (-219% tax rate).
- Revenue grew steadily by 25% YoY to ₹3,563 Cr, reflecting strong loan book expansion.
- Financing margins witnessed significant compression, falling to 16% in Q4 FY2026 from 36% YoY.
- Borrowings have expanded aggressively, reaching ₹1.41 Lakh Cr as of Mar 2026 to fund infrastructure projects.
- The company maintains a strong sovereign-backed profile but shows high leverage and negative free cash flows.
- Operating expenses and interest costs rose sharply, offsetting much of the operational revenue growth.
